Windows is always going to use as much as it needs. If you had 8gig of ram, it is going to try and use as much of that as possible.
It's not a problem unless you have all your ram used and it needs swap to process your requests.

The more you have the more will be used. Its a good thing and hardly a bad thing unless you notice some performace problems such as windows telling you your swap file is running out of space. Otherwise it will just speed things up as things will not needed to be pulled out of the swap file off of the hard drive.
